Abstract
The utility model discloses a kind of Mechanical Design Teaching model supports, including model support ontology, the side of the model support ontology offers rotation slot, it is installed with rotary electric machine on the bottom side inner wall of the rotation slot, it is installed with first gear on the output shaft of rotary electric machine, second gear is engaged in first gear, the upper and lower ends of second gear are rotatablely equipped with rotating bar, one end that two rotating bars are located remotely from each other is rotatably installed in respectively on the top side and bottom side inner wall of rotation slot, the side of the second gear extends to outside rotation slot, and fixing sleeve is connected to fixed block, side of the fixed block far from second gear is rotatablely equipped with transverse slat, the bottom side of the transverse slat offers fixing groove, mounting blocks are installed in fixing groove, the bottom side of mounting blocks extends to outside fixing groove, and it is rotatablely equipped with connecting rod.The utility model can be convenient for the direction position and angle position of automatic adjustment transverse slat, simple in structure, easy to operate.
